This article compares the television industry in Indonesia during the reign of the Old Order, the New Order, and the Reform Era. A full review of television broadcasting in all eras is still rarely carried out by Indonesian researchers. The author uses qualitative research methods in the form of comparative studies and library studies based on secondary data. In this comparison, the author focuses on eleven aspects of the problem, namely; the system of broadcasting, ownership, the form of broadcasting institutions, objectives, funding, broadcast coverage, control, and supervision, licensing, press freedom, media content trends, and society in relation to the television industry. The author found that although since independence Indonesia has been based on Pancasila democracy, in every era of government there have been differences in TV broadcasting arrangements. The Old Order period was more dominated by the role of government. This situation continued during the first 20 years of the New Order government, but in the last ten years of the New Order, the private sector dominated the TV industry. This dominance has continued into the reform era and treats society as a market and a political object. During all periods, it is the government which determines to license, and the implementation of the Broadcasting Act is not strictly enforced. A less strict attitude in the implementation of the Broadcasting Act indicates that the country is flexible and endeavours to find ways to compromise with stakeholders.

The education system as we know it today is the result of educational developments that have grown in the history of our nation's experience. There have been some writings discussing the regulations of education policy in Indonesia from time to time, but this paper examines the comparison of education policies from the Old Order era to the implementation of education policies to the work cabinet period. Through a literature review, this paper aims to describe how education policy regulations in Indonesia were during the Old Order, New Order, Reform, and Work Cabinet Periods. The results of this study reveal as has been explained in the discussion, that during the New Order era education only took place in terms of quantity without being matched by quality developments. In this period, it is to create as many educated graduates as possible without producing quality teaching and educational outcomes. The curricula used at this time were the 1968 curriculum, the 1975 curriculum, the 1984 curriculum, and the 1994 curriculum. However, education in the next period during the New Order period was not said to be fully successful, so in the next period of the reform period, improvements were needed, both in the field of curriculum. as well as in terms of the teaching staff. The curricula used in this reform era are the Competency-Based Curriculum (KBK) and the Education Unit Level Curriculum (KTSP), and K13.

Since its inception, Golkar is a party that is carried by various functional groups with the aim of building political power to challenge the PKI. Since the reform era, Golkar has been abandoned by many of its support groups that have formed factionalism. The purpose of this study is to analyze the change of factionalism in the internal of Golkar in the post-New Order. The research method used is qualitative descriptive. The data used are secondary data derived from journals, books, and internet. The results show that: Golkar post-New Order experienced many changes in term of factionalism; factionalism that occurred during the New Order period stemmed from functional groups, while after the reforms became a factionalism based on personalism.
